What Is the ₹1,000 Crore Benchmark—and Why It Matters
In the context of Indian cinema, crossing ₹1,000 crore in global box office collections is considered a rare and prestigious accomplishment. It places a film among the highest-grossing productions in the country’s history.
This benchmark matters because it indicates:
- Massive audience reach across regions and languages
- Strong international performance
- Effective marketing and distribution strategies
- High repeat value and sustained theatrical run
However, it is also important to understand that this figure includes worldwide collections, not just domestic earnings.

How the Film Industry Enabled This Growth
The success of Dhurandhar 2 is not an isolated event—it is the result of broader industry evolution.
Expansion of Distribution Networks
In recent years, films have been released simultaneously across thousands of screens worldwide. This allows producers to maximize revenue in a short period.
Role of Digital Marketing
Promotions today are no longer limited to television and print. Social media campaigns, teaser drops, and influencer collaborations help build anticipation well before release.
Multiplex Growth
The increase in multiplex screens, especially in smaller cities, has expanded the paying audience base.

Who Benefits—and Who Doesn’t
While blockbuster success brings many advantages, its benefits are not evenly distributed.
Beneficiaries
- Major production houses
- Top actors and directors
- Large distributors
Challenges for Smaller Films
- Reduced screen availability
- Limited marketing budgets
- Difficulty competing for audience attention
This imbalance raises questions about diversity in storytelling.
